New Mexico, a southwestern U.S. state, offers a diverse landscape ranging from arid deserts to snowy peaks. It's known for its rich cultural heritage and vibrant blend of Native American and Hispanic influences, visible in its art, festivals, and cuisine. The state is home to a number of historical landmarks, including ancient pueblos and Spanish missions. Adventure enthusiasts will find plenty to do, from hiking in stunning national parks to exploring unique geological formations. The state's natural beauty is highlighted in locations such as White Sands National Park, where monumental dunes of gypsum sand stretch as far as the eye can see. Meanwhile, the Carlsbad Caverns National Park offers an incredible underground landscape. For those fascinated by history, museums and cultural sites provide insights into the region's past, including its pivotal role in the atomic age. With a variety of festivals year-round, New Mexico is a cultural hub that captivates visitors with its artistic appeal.
